(CNN) Two former Houston Police officers involved a botched raid that left two people dead were indicted Wednesday by a Texas grand jury, prosecutors said. The second former officer, Steven Bryant, was indicted for tampering with a government record, Ogg said. "In this case, because officers lied, people died," Ogg told reporters. The two officers were part of the tactical team that was involved in a raid of a home on January 28, 2019 that killed Rhogena Nicholas and Dennis Tuttle and their dog in the home. The raid injured several Houston officers on the team, including Goines.
